Job Summary:

The Real Estate Coordinator's primary responsibilities for this job are to provide support to the Regional Real Estate Coordinator and Real Estate Team.

Job Responsibilities:

  • Support real estate representatives by researching lease agreements, documents and landlord communications to answer questions
  • Receive calls from landlords regarding lease agreements and forward to real estate representatives
  • Input lease agreements into Quattro, attach copies and fill out all necessary forms
  • Manage paperwork and system records for renewals, new leases and payment reductions
  • Input landlord payment information into system and review checks to verify correct amounts are being paid to landlords
  • Maintain files containing lease agreements, payment information and contact information
  • Manage, monitor and report monthly on the progress of lease terminations, lease payments, increases and renewals
  • Work closely with the finance department and create monthly reports showing variance between lease payments and budgeted amounts; research any discrepancies and report to finance
  • Receive emails and calls reporting issues with sites (graffiti, bird droppings etc) and forward to appropriate group for maintenance

Other duties as assigned or requested

About Clear Channel Outdoor

Clear Channel Outdoor is one of the worlds largest outdoor advertising companies, reaching people in more than 31 countries across North America, Latin America, Europe and Asia. This includes 44 of the 50 largest markets in the United States and a growing digital platform that now offers over 1,400 digital billboards across 28 U.S. markets. Clear Channel Airports is the premier innovator of contemporary display concepts. The Company, a brand division of Clear Channel Outdoor Americas (NYSE: CCO), one of the world's largest outdoor advertising companies, currently operates more than 260 airport ... programs across the globe and has a presence in 28 of the top 50 U.S. markets with major airports. We help advertisers create inspiring out-of-home campaigns via traditional and digital formats in roadside, urban, transit and airport environments, on street furniture and at retail near point of sale. We enable brands to engage with people on the move, and are pioneering the integration of out-of-home with mobile and social media to turn awareness and inspiration into engagement and purchase.
